Now, the season of advent is upon each of us and our loved ones. The word “advent” means “arrival,” and it signifies the coming of Baby Jesus Immanuel – “God with us” (Matthew 1:23). Since the Creator God made human beings and walked and talked with them every day in the Garden, He has been with us. When we reflect on the presence of Immanuel God during the course of our faith journey, we cannot express our gratitude enough to the Lord. God desires to be in the company of each of us, His people, when we assemble to worship Him during the Advent season.
